LM2687LD/NOPB Description
The LM2687LD/NOPB is a surface-mount, charge pump DC switching voltage regulator designed by Texas Instruments. This regulator offers an adjustable output voltage, making it highly versatile for various applications. It operates within an input voltage range of 2.7V to 5.5V and can deliver a maximum output current of 10mA. The regulator features a negative output configuration, which is ideal for applications requiring a negative voltage supply.
LM2687LD/NOPB Features
- Adjustable Output Voltage: The LM2687LD/NOPB provides an adjustable output voltage, allowing designers to tailor the regulator to specific application requirements.
- Wide Input Voltage Range: With an input voltage range from 2.7V to 5.5V, this regulator is suitable for a variety of power supply scenarios.
- Low Output Current: The regulator is designed to deliver a maximum output current of 10mA, making it ideal for low-power applications.
- Negative Output Configuration: The negative output configuration is particularly useful for applications requiring a negative voltage supply.
- Charge Pump Topology: Utilizing a charge pump topology, the LM2687LD/NOPB offers efficient voltage conversion with a switching frequency of 110kHz.
- Surface Mount Packaging: The surface-mount package type ensures easy integration into compact and space-constrained designs.
- Obsolete Status: While the product is marked as obsolete, it remains a reliable choice for existing designs and legacy systems.
- Compliance and Safety: The LM2687LD/NOPB is REACH unaffected and RoHS3 compliant, ensuring it meets environmental and safety standards.
- Moisture Sensitivity Level: With an MSL of 1 (Unlimited), the regulator is suitable for a wide range of manufacturing environments.
